Transaction 59bc16866c928b56fb0871e8c10f6140923a7204bb164eb177607d42f141a44e
1 Input
1 Output
-
59bc16866c928b56fb0871e8c10f6140923a7204bb164eb177607d42f141a44e:0
- value
- 11972709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26337d1ead8a74648b098fb82cb0501571cb97f7 OP_EQUAL
- address
- 35B1HLLx2G8U8o1sPxcZKk7mwhgLHQzozY